Move the processing code under pipeline/
Preparing to merge this repository into a combined astrophotography repo. session-scripts/ becomes pipeline/ because the scripts import layout.py from their own directory and must stay together, and because 'pipeline' says what it is rather than how it came about. observing/ stays at the top level: observing plans are not processing code.

"""Write the final flagged-object CSVs, with an identification and verdict
|
||||
attached to every row.
|
||||
|
||||
Two files are produced.
|
||||
|
||||
mo-flagged-objects.csv is the short list: the six sources that survived every
|
||||
cut of the transient search, plus the (zero) moving-object candidates, each
|
||||
with the identification established from published catalogues and an explicit
|
||||
assessment. This is the file to read.
|
||||
|
||||
mo-transient-candidates.csv (written by mo_transient.py) is the long list of
|
||||
all 567 catalogue non-matches, kept for completeness. Almost all of them are
|
||||
faint objects below the depth at which Gaia DR3 and SkyMapper DR2 are complete
|
||||
against this galaxy, and are not individually assessed.
|
||||
"""
